Chief Sealth International High School – Chinese 1A, 1B
Mar 2026 · 2nd Semester
This introductory course is designed for beginners and provides a foundational understanding of Mandarin Chinese, with a focus on speaking, listening, reading, and writing skills. Students will acquire basic vocabulary, essential grammar structures, and practical conversational phrases for everyday situations. Emphasis is placed on developing accurate pronunciation, mastering Pinyin (the Romanized system for Chinese characters), and understanding basic sentence structures. They will be able to handle simple, everyday life situations. Topics like pinyin, tons, greeting, family, school, hobbies, daily activities will be covered. Aspects of Chinese culture will also be, including customs, traditions, and the significance of language in Chinese society will be addressed. At the end of the year students will reach at least novice-mid level of language proficiency.
Grades: 9, 10, 11, 12
